Let us start with the technology. R.I.M. is a method to produce plastic parts by low stress injection of thermoset resins in moulds. Mostly, different types of moulds are relevant, amongst which resin moulds are probably the most ceaselessly used. Indeed, most producers focuse on small series moulds, built around a master part produced by speedy prototyping strategies such as stereolithography or HSM. It means that different moulds are used, relying on commerce off series, measurement of the part and speed. To put it briefly, listed below are among the approaches in perform of amount: immediately machined tools; resin instruments with fibre reinforcement (200-300 parts); no master wanted; hybrid instruments (50-one hundred shots); ureol tools (a hundred-200 mouldings); silicone tools (up to 25-50 pictures); and finally master primarily based tools. And lastly, resin instruments with aluminium backing (as much as 300-one thousand components), dependent on half complexity, R.I.M. material.

Presently, for large automotive components epoxy tools with fibre backing are used as a substitute of concrete backing, consisting of layers of resin charged with glass fibres. The first supremacy of this mould sort is its low weight, meaning that giant and really large moulds can be made which stay easy to handle.

But, Response Injection Moulding is commonly the reply when more than one copy is required. Indeed, large, useful parts might be produced within short lead times and at very competitive prices. The R.I.M. supplies enable prototyping and small manufacturing series of lightweight and mechanically purposeful products, which is a typical software within the automotive sector. We proceed to the very fact that the production cycle time is relatively short allowing a throughput of reaction 30 components per week (depending on size and complexity). On high of all that R.I.M. is the perfect answer for giant elements corresponding to housings or automotive elements, merchandise with thick wall sections, complex parts, mechanically functional products (prototypes or small manufacturing sequence), and quantities from 10 to 1000.

In conclusion some good causes to decide on R.I.M.: brief lead occasions, low tooling funding value, supplies with properties close to the ultimate product, ultimate for big elements in small sequence, e.g. medical tools, a hundred% functionality & excessive impression power, excellent temperature resistance and surface end permits high performance painting.
